        private static bool UpdateCatch(CrabPotCatch @catch)
        {
            // Must be a valid location.
            var location = Game1.getLocationFromName(@catch.Location);

            if (location == null)
            {
                return(false);
            }

            // Conditions must hold.
            if ([email protected]())
            {
                return(false);
            }

            // Update the Crab Pots.
            Rectangle area = @catch.adjustArea(location);

            Monitor.Log($"Updating Crab Pot catches in area {area} (fishing area {@catch.FishingArea}) of location '{location.Name}'.",
                        LogLevel.Trace);
            foreach (SObject @object in location.objects.Values)
            {
                // Must be a Crab Pot.
                if (@object is not CrabPot pot)
                {
                    continue;
                }

                // Must be in the right area and fishing area.
                if (!area.Contains(Utility.Vector2ToPoint(pot.TileLocation)) ||
                    (@catch.FishingArea != -1 &&
                     location.getFishingLocation(pot.TileLocation) != @catch.FishingArea))
                {
                    continue;
                }

                UpdatePot(@catch, pot);
            }
            return(true);
        }

        private static void UpdatePot(CrabPotCatch @catch, CrabPot pot)
        {
            // Check for the Mariner and Luremaster professions.
            var  owner      = Game1.getFarmer(pot.owner.Value);
            bool luremaster = owner != null && owner.professions.Contains(11);
            bool mariner    = (owner != null && owner.professions.Contains(10)) ||
                              (pot.owner.Value == 0L && Game1.player.professions.Contains(11));

            // Don't proceed unless the pot is baited or Luremaster applies.
            if (pot.bait.Value == null && !luremaster)
            {
                return;
            }

            // The game stops here if the pot has an item, but we must continue.

            // Set the pot as ready for harvest. This is probably redundant.
            pot.tileIndexToShow       = 714;
            pot.readyForHarvest.Value = true;

            // Seed the RNG.
            Random random = new ((int)Game1.stats.DaysPlayed +
                                 (int)Game1.uniqueIDForThisGame / 2 +
                                 (int)pot.TileLocation.X * 1000 +
                                 (int)pot.TileLocation.Y);

            // Maybe catch trash.
            double trashChance = 0.2 + @catch.ExtraTrashChance;

            if (!mariner && !(random.NextDouble() > trashChance))
            {
                pot.heldObject.Value = new SObject(random.Next(168, 173), 1);
                return;
            }

            // Search for a suitable fish.
            var fishes = Helper.Content.Load <Dictionary <int, string> > ("Data\\Fish",
                                                                          ContentSource.GameContent);
            List <int> candidates = new ();

            foreach (var fish in fishes)
            {
                string[] fields = fish.Value.Split('/');

                // Must be a Crab Pot fish.
                if (!fish.Value.Contains("trap"))
                {
                    continue;
                }

                // Must be the right catch type.
                if (fields[4] == (@catch.OceanCatches ? "freshwater" : "ocean"))
                {
                    continue;
                }

                // Mariners get all fish with equal chance.
                if (mariner)
                {
                    candidates.Add(fish.Key);
                    continue;
                }

                // Roll for getting the fish immediately.
                double chance = Convert.ToDouble(fields[2]);
                if (random.NextDouble() < chance)
                {
                    pot.heldObject.Value = new SObject(fish.Key, 1);
                    return;
                }
            }

            // Fall back to a random selection of the candidates.
            if (candidates.Count == 0)
            {
                candidates.AddRange(new int[] { 168, 169, 170, 171, 172 });
            }
            pot.heldObject.Value = new SObject(candidates[random.Next(candidates.Count)], 1);
        }
